A Web browser designed for HP's DOS-based OmniGo and LX hand-held devices
is due to ship later this month from DNA Software Inc.
The $99 Web/LX browser provides support for a graphical user interface on
the systems, in addition to a communications stack that brings TCP/IP
support to HP's hand-held offerings, said David Shier, vice president of
DNA Software.
The software will support five fonts and GIF file formats for monochrome
graphics displays but won't support extended features such as Java or
Virtual Reality Modeling Language, Shier added.
The software will be distributed by Shier Systems and Software Inc., in
Westlake Village, Calif.
